January GEM Award Winner - Tracey Cosgrove

 

Stevenson January Winner - Tracey Cosgrove, Art Teacher

Tracey’s statement:

Wayne-Westland is definitely a community district. I enjoy the sense of community pride we bring to the table and share with our students. I love being able to pass on my passion for Art and all that it does for us. I am fascinated with what my students create when given the chance. It's a wonderful opportunity to be apart of this community and district. 

 

Kimberly Doman/Principal statement:

Tracey Cosgrove is an exceptional educator. She is passionate about providing unique and cross curricular opportunities for learning for her students. She is frequently working to learn new techniques and skills by taking art and jewelry classes. She is also working with the department leaders of other core areas to support the goals within our school improvement plan. She is a leader within the building, serving as our building rep, our Department lead, and member of our School Improvement team. She serves as a member of our Data and Disproportionality team and frequently is reviewing our data with the intent to provide the best learning experience for not just the students in her classroom, but for the entire building as a whole. Tracey is also the lead member of the Sunshine Committee within Stevenson where the goal is to keep staff morale up and plan monthly events to hang out together and make new connections. Her dedication to her career and making a lasting impression on her students is admirable. We love having Tracey in our building. Our students are incredibly lucky.
